The University shall maintain accurate records of property, plant, and equipment, in accordance with generally accepted accounting principles. The University shall comply with State Board of Higher Education Policy 802.6, part 5.c, which indicates that University's must "Be accountable for all funds, property, equipment and other facilities assigned or provided to the institution to ensure that all are used consistent with laws, policies or other specific requirements;".
All additions, deletions, and transfers of property, plant, and equipment shall be properly authorized. University expenditures for tangible personal property items used actively in university operations that exceed $5,000 and benefit a period exceeding one year shall be capitalized and inventoried on an annual basis. Library Books will be capitalized in accordance with guidelines issued by the University System.
